What could change, or not, for hand baggage?

EU transport ministers proposed that passengers should be guaranteed one free personal item, measuring up to 40x30x15cm (including wheels and handles) – or which could reasonably fit under a plane seat. Kylian Mbappe scored his 50th international goal as France beat Nations League hosts Germany in their third-place play-off.

The captain finished well for the 45th-minute opener following a pass from Real Madrid team-mate Aurelien Tchouameni. And Mbappe set up the second goal six minutes from time when he pounced on a mistake from Robin Koch and unselfishly squared the ball for Michael Olise to slot into the empty net.
